@charset "utf-8";
/* CSS Document */
.header {
	margin:0;
	padding:0;
}

img {
	border:none;
}

.header {
	position:relative;
	height:37px;
	width: expression((documentElement.clientWidth < 980) ? "980px" : "100%")!important;
	width:100%;
	min-width:980px;	
	background:url(header_bg.gif) repeat-x;
}

.header .nav {
	position:relative;
	top:0;
	left:10px;
	height:35px;
	display:inline-block;
	width:500px;
}

.header .myposition {
	position:relative;
	width:250px;
	top:10px;
	right:20px;
	float:right;
	font-size:12px;
	color:#FFF;
	text-align:right;
}
.header .myposition a {
	text-decoration:none;
	color:#FFF;
	margin-left:5px;
}
.header .myposition a:hover {
	color:#ffe400;
}
.header .nav_a {
	position:relative;
	font-size:12px;
	text-decoration:none;
	color:#FFF;
	height:35px;
	line-height:35px;
	padding-left:10px;
	padding-right:10px;
	display:inline-block;
	text-align:center;
	font-weight:bold;
}

.header .nav_a a {
	color:#FFFFF !important;
}

.header .nav_a a:hover {
	color:#ff9800;
}


.ul_nav {
	position:relative;
	list-style:none;
}

.ul_li_nav {
	position:relative;
	float:left;
	display:inline-block;
}

.nav_a:hover {
	background:#6d6d6d;	
	color:#ffe400;
}

.logo {
	position:relative;
	width:119px;
	height:35px;
	float:left;
	background: url(r_logo.gif) no-repeat 50%;
}

.logo_link {
	display:inline-block;
	width:119px;
	height:35px;

}

.my_ruanko {
	background:url(0007.gif) no-repeat 10px;
	padding-left:30px;
	margin-left:20px;
	text-decoration:none;
	color:#fff;
}
/*-------------------子菜单样式----------------*/
.application_box {
	position:absolute;
	top:35px;
	left:0;
	width:170px;
	height:auto;
	border:1px solid #5c5c5c;
	background:#fbfbfb;
	visibility:hidden;
	padding-top:5px;
	padding-bottom:5px;
	z-index:1000;
}
.application_boxul {
	position:absolute;
	top:0;
	left:0;
	width:170px;
	height:auto;
	border:1px solid #5c5c5c;
	background:#fbfbfb;
	visibility:hidden;
	padding-top:5px;
	padding-bottom:5px;
	z-index:1000;
}

.application_box li {
	position:relative;
	list-style:none;
	height:27px;
	line-height:27px;
	width:160px;
	left:5px;
	border-bottom:1px solid #ddd;
}

.application_box li a {
	position:relative;
	display:block;
	padding-top:2px;
	height:24px;
	line-height:24px;
	font-size:12px;
	text-decoration:none;
	color:#000;
}
.application_box li a:hover {
	background:#eee;
}
.application_box li a img {
	position:relative;
	top:4px;
	margin-left:10px;
	margin-right:5px;
}

.application_box li span {
	position:absolute;
	bottom:0px;
	left:120px;
	display:inline-block;
}

.application_box li span a:hover {
	text-decoration:underline;
	background:#fdfdfd;
}
